Established in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been engaged to reducing the time to market for innovators engineering new medical devices. The company differentiates it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times of approximately 1 to 3 days—an achievement infeasible with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ard realized the significant need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for fast-paced development programs designing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is essential in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Complementing rout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Medical Device Sterilization Matters

Managing infections remains a cornerstone of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Appropriate sterilization of medical devices greatly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ers alike. Insufficient sterilization can cause outbreaks of critical di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Methods of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has progressed substantially over the last century, applying a variety of methods suited to diverse types of devices and materials. Some of the most frequently utilized techniques include:

Steam Autoclaving

Autoclaving remains the most widespread and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is speedy, affordable, and eco-conscious,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

High-tech Materials and Device Complexity

The rise of advanced med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ization processes capable of handling elaborate materials. Improvements in sterilization include methods particularly low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ging fine components.

Advanced Digital Traceability

With advances in digital technology, verification of sterilization activities is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er thorough docum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time signals, significantly mitigating human error and strengthening patient safety.
